Corporations have been selling expensive health remedies in
stores for quite a while, but there have always been individuals who
resisted the marketing of these traditional remedies and opted for all
natural cures. And who can blame them? Who wouldn't want to be able to
safely and inexpensively relieve their ills from the solace of their own
home?
Now major companies have jumped on the bandwagon and have started to create natural health remedies themselves. This is predictable, as people made it clear for a long time that they did indeed want natural health remedies and would consequently trade money for them. The companies have simply stepped up to the plate and capitalized on that desire.
Natural remedies are now readily available for just about any ill out there. It is difficult to find a health problem that does not have an offered natural remedy obtainable. Natural health remedies range from simple home remedy type plans to follow using useful household ingredients, to complicated supplements formulated from super foods and containing natural vitamins and minerals.
Do these new age treatments and remedies for troublesome ailments really work? Results seem all over the place, and depend largely on the condition at hand. Don't make the mistake of believing that natural health products are the answer to everything. There are many conditions which are mechanical in nature and thus cannot be influenced by mere dietary changes or by taking supplements. However, these products can prove effective in dealing with conditions that are related to the overall health of a person.
There are a few factors that contribute to the popularity of these natural health products. For one, the internet allows word to spread quickly when a natural remedy works. For another thing, thanks to celebrities, natural stuff is "in" right now and it will be that way for a long time to come.
Much of this popularity is warranted, however. Natural health products certainly tend to be kinder to the body than harsh and abrasive chemicals, and they can also be much less expensive. Many natural health remedies even call for the use of very cheap and common household ingredients.
Despite the fact that new-fangled remedies don't work all of the time, you must concede that natural health is definitely growing in popularity. And is it really any wonder? Between increasing medical costs and harsh over the counter products, the idea of being able to safely and inexpensively remedy an ailment from the comfort of one's home seems like a boon.
